Transaction 156ed3d936d96c78da9e1348007b70c52c41069b9ea52edc494eb5139d402039
1 Input
2 Outputs
- 156ed3d936d96c78da9e1348007b70c52c41069b9ea52edc494eb5139d402039:0
- 156ed3d936d96c78da9e1348007b70c52c41069b9ea52edc494eb5139d402039:1
value 1588289
address 32nwc7Rpfdy4HVdp88ApxHpSis8GSmRgvn
value 15449288
address 19DiPMpxT7KLRjsMcHgfRCknx9GsLhrcdN